Oklahoma Grain Elevator Cash Bids as of 2:00 p.m. Friday, October 11, 2019 Oklahoma City, OK Fri Oct 11, 2019 OK Dept. of Ag-USDA Market News
Oklahoma grain elevator cash bids as of 2:00 pm Friday.


***This report will not be issued on Monday Oct. 14th due to the Columbus
Day Holiday.***


U.S. No 1 HARD RED WINTER WHEAT (BU): .16 to .17 higher. 3.41-3.97.
Davis 3.41; Frederick, Hooker 3.80; Hobart, Keyes 3.85; Buffalo 3.86;
Temple 3.87; Lawton 3.88; Alva, Cherokee, Clinton 3.93; El Reno,
Manchester, Okarche, Weatherford 3.94; Eldorado, Geary, Medford, Okeene,
Ponca City, Shattuck, Watonga 3.95; Banner 3.96; Perry, Stillwater 3.97;
Gulf 5.19 1/2.


MILO (CWT): .32 to .33 higher. 5.86-6.39.
Eldorado N/A; Buffalo 5.86; Alva, Manchester, Ponca City 6.04;
Weatherford 6.07; Medford 6.14; Shattuck 6.21; Keyes, Lawton 6.30;
Hobart, Hooker 6.39.


SOYBEANS (BU): .12 higher. 8.06-8.41.
Hooker 8.06; Shattuck 8.11; Buffalo 8.16; Stillwater 8.21; Alva 8.31;
Manchester, Weatherford 8.36; Medford, Ponca City 8.41; Gulf 9.77 1/2.


CORN (BU): .18 higher. 3.73-4.13.
Lawton 3.73; Manchester 3.81; Medford, Ponca City 3.83;
Weatherford 4.00; Keyes, Shattuck 4.08; Hooker 4.13; Gulf 4.45 1/4.


Grade 41, Leaf 4, Staple 34 Cotton in Southwestern Oklahoma average
60.38 cents per pound.


Source: Oklahoma Dept of AG-USDA Market News, Oklahoma City, OK
